Apple's highly anticipated iOS 17 is here — an update the tech giant first unveiled during its WWDC event in June. The tech giant will introduce the update to users by offering new apps, as well as significant upgrades to Messages, FaceTime, and AirDrop. 

iOS 17 Update Recap

This year's major iOS update includes a new Journal app similar to Notes. It lets users jot down their thoughts, create entries, and receive personalized suggestions based on their recent activities and photos — all with end-to-end encryption to ensure the user's security and privacy.

Meanwhile, FaceTime will get new voice and video notes that users can leave if the person they're trying to call is not available at a given time. 

In Messages, users can enjoy new emoji stickers, as well as create Live Stickers that users can make from their existing photos. Other updates in Messages include:

  • Improved search filters
  • Catch-up arrow that directs to the last read message
  • Improved location sharing
  • Audio message transcription
  • Check-In feature 

iOS 17 will also come with a new StandBy lock screen display for iPhones not in use, a new NameDrop feature that allows two contacts to share, listen, and watch content together as long as they're within close proximity, smarter Autocorrect, and small improvements to the Phone and Live Voicemail apps. 

How to Install iOS 17

To install the latest software update, users can head to Settings > General > About > Software Update to download iOS 17. 

iOS 17 will require 3.62GB of available storage in order to be installed, and will not be available for models earlier than the iPhone XS from 2018.
